The magpie is one of the most intelligent non-human species, able to distinguish themselves from their reflections. In many cultures, they are linked to superstitions, with the rhyme “One for the Sorrow” that illustrates how their appearances can be a form of fortune-telling. Via the embodiment of the magpie as an allegorical notion to shift away from the human-centered perspective, the film aims to create speculations of possible futures through the eyes of the magpie as a prophet—seer—diviner, reinforced by its mythical qualities retold in folklores and legends.
Farewell Show - Live In London is a live album by the band Delirious?. In November 2009, Delirious? played at the Hammersmith Apollo in London to record their final gig as a live concert album, DVD and Blu-ray in front of a sold-out crowd of 5,000. With this show they closed their "History Makers - Farewell Tour" which included 11 gigs in Germany, Austria, Switzerland, The Netherlands and the UK.

London’s 2012 Olympic Park in Stratford is the epitome of contemporary masterplanning: the choreographed regeneration of a post-industrial area into an economically thriving zone centred on creative industries. The park itself contains iconic structures commissioned for the games: the Olympic Stadium, Velodrome and Anish Kapoor’s Orbit tower for the multinational steel conglomerate ArcelorMittal. Delirious New Wick explores the disjunction between the masterplan and the adjacent area of Hackney Wick, a place with an unusually high density of artist-run colonies. Teleporter Pavilions beam the player into inaccessible areas - up into the voids of Anish Kapoor’s tower and into the Velodrome flying over the town below. Here, the player can take a critic’s role, assessing the government-endorsed regeneration strategies as they witness conflicts between the area’s past and future.

Dagi is a famous actor, but a heavy drinker. At one point his condition becomes critical and he ends up in the hospital where he is diagnosed with delirium tremens. Having lost sensation in his limbs, incapable of grasping what is happening around him, imagination plays tricks on him, and as he falls into delirium he finds himself in surreal situations. Once he comes round, he realizes that his life has been ruined and attempts suicide. Saved at the last moment, Dagi remains in the hospital overcome with apathy. However, things change when Lisa, a therapist from England, appears with a revolutionary new method of therapy for severely affected patients known as - psychodrama.

This film takes the audience on a journey into the wondrous world of audiophilia. We get acquainted with a group of hardcore sound junkies and follow them in their individual quests for The Ultimate Sound Experience. For some it involves just building a new amplifier, for others it involves bizarre and mad projects. Or what do you call a man who is tearing down his house just in order to build a new one from scratch - to achieve better acoustics ... ?
